Beyond weapons and suit enhancements, Samus acquires several utility items that are vital for exploration, interaction, and combat. These items often unlock new traversal options or provide unique ways to interact with the environment.

Utility Items
  • Grapple Beam: Acquired on Bryyo. Allows Samus to swing across large gaps using grapple points and pull down specific objects.
  • Grapple Voltage: An upgrade to the Grapple Beam, acquired on Elysia. Allows Samus to siphon energy from power conduits or enemies, often used to activate machinery or overload enemy shields.
  • Screw Attack: Acquired late in the game. A powerful offensive and defensive maneuver in Morph Ball form, allowing Samus to become temporarily invulnerable and damage enemies by rolling into them. Also allows for extended jumps.
  • Ship Grapple: An upgrade for your Gunship. Allows your ship to grapple and move large objects in the environment, often used to clear paths or solve large-scale puzzles.

Each utility item significantly expands Samus's capabilities, making previously inaccessible areas reachable and providing new tactical options in combat. Remember to experiment with new items as soon as you acquire them to understand their full potential.
